About the role

If you are motivated by delivering first class customer service and committed to improving the customer experience then we would very much like to hear from you.

We are looking to recruit an enthusiastic ICT Support officer to join our ICT support team. As ICT Support Officer you will:

  • support ICT systems including servers, PCs, Laptops, iPads and other ICT equipment as needed
  • act as first line support for users at the site and will be expected to support staff and pupils with their ICT issues
  • have previous experience of ICT support and a good understanding of networks and IT systems
  • apply logical and creative skills to support and develop systems
  • be polite, approachable and have a can do attitude

You will be expected to work predominantly at Powys Schools, whilst also undertaking some duties at Canolfan Rheidol, Aberystwyth, Penmorfa, Aberaeron  and other supported locations as needed.

The ability to communicate effectively through the medium of Welsh and English is essential.

Where you'll work

Customer Contact & ICT

Our service has a range of responsibilities from providing advice and support to the residents of Ceredigion to providing corporate support via our ICT, reception and mailroom teams.  Our service is responsible for the following functions: 

  • Civil Registration: Birth, deaths and marriages.
  • Corporate Customer Services: Blue badge; Contact centre; Mailroom and scanning; Receptions.
  • ICT and Information Management: Archives and modern records; ICT support; Infrastructure and security; Project and application support; Reprographics, Technical support, Software development.
  • Library Services
